7. So, What are microservices?
“Loosely coupled service oriented architecture
with bounded contexts”
Adrian Cockcroft
“Applications that fit in your head”
James Lewis
04/07/2016 @danielbryantuk
8. So, What are microservices?
• Architectural style - build services around biz capability
• Enable evolutionary architecture and scaling (teams and Tech)
• single App composed of (interchangable) multiple services
• Services Running as individual processes, individually deployable
• lightweight external communication (e.g. rest over http)
• Potentially polyglot Language and Data stores
• Minimum centralised management

11. The Perfect Storm?
• Collaborative processes
– increasing requirements for speed from the business
– Agile, lean and Devops
• Programmable infrastructure
– Driven out from Deployment at scale (google, netflix, amazon)
– Config management, Cloud and containers
• Open source
– Sharing of technology and knowledge
– Download, consume and contribute
